Katie Taylor will not be fighting on Andy Lee undercard

Andy Lee’s management confirmed the U-turn on Tuesday morning

Katie Taylor has performed a surprise U-turn and will no longer be on the undercard for Andy Lee's World Championship title defence next month.

Only four days ago it had been announced that the amateur European, World and Olympic champion, would be involved in the Thomond Park fight between Lee and Billy Joe Saunders on September 19th.

There had been an added bite to the inclusion with Taylor, who has not been beaten in a championship bout for 10 years and had previously fought on the undercard of Bernard Dunne in The Point in 2009, responding on Twitter to Saunders' offensive comments about women a week earlier.

Yet after several days of toing and froing between Taylor and Lee’s management teams and agreement could not be reached.

Lee's trainer, manager and coach Adam Booth said on Tuesday that; "We believe we did everything we could to make this event happen but unfortunately on this occasion, the outcome was not to be."

While Taylor’s management Devlin Sports released a brief statement on her behalf saying;

"It is with great regret that Katie Taylor will not be taking part on the Andy Lee undercard at Thomond Park on September 19th. We would like to wish Andy all the best."
